The shower arm is a plumbing fixture that attaches to the wall of a shower or bathtub, providing the necessary connection for a shower head. It is typically made of durable materials such as stainless steel or brass, and is designed to withstand the demands of daily use. The shower arm can be adjusted to different angles and lengths, allowing for maximum flexibility and convenience. Some shower arms also feature a swivel joint, which allows the shower head to be moved in different directions. They are easy to install and maintain, and can be used in both residential and commercial settings. They are available in different finishes like chrome, brushed nickel, oil rubbed bronze and many more to match with bathroom decor. A shower arm is a plumbing component that connects the shower valve to the showerhead. It typically has a straight or angled design and is used to direct the flow of water from the plumbing to the showerhead.
To maintain your shower arm, you should regularly clean it to remove any buildup of minerals or soap scum. You can do this by wiping the arm with a damp cloth, and then drying it with a dry cloth. You should also check the arm for leaks and make sure it is tight.
If your shower arm is leaking, or if the showerhead is not providing an adequate flow of water, it may need to be replaced. If the arm is also damaged, it may be a good idea to replace it.
